10.04 image in UEC store crashing on boot

Bug #719140 reported by Luca Invernizzi
10
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Eucalyptus
New
Undecided
Daniel Nurmi

Bug Description

Hello,
I have installed UEC from the Maverick server amd64 cd, with the standard configuration: everything except the NC on the same machine, and the NC on a separate one. It is working great with the image of Ubuntu 10.04 i386, downloaded through the UEC store.
The amd64 version of the Ubuntu 10.04 image (also downloaded through the store), however, fails to boot.

There seem to be others facing the same problem [0],[1].

I've attached the full boot log. Here's the interesting part:

Begin: Mounting root file system... ...
Begin: Running /scripts/local-top ...
Done.
[ 3.990704] Intel(R) PRO/1000 Network Driver - version 7.3.21-k5-NAPI
[ 3.991969] Copyright (c) 1999-2006 Intel Corporation.
Begin: Running /scripts/local-premount ...
[ 4.090535] FDC 0 is a S82078B
[ 4.093643] ACPI: PCI Interrupt Link [LNKB] enabled at IRQ 10
[ 4.094741] e1000 0000:00:02.0: PCI INT A -> Link[LNKB] -> GSI 10 (level, high) -> IRQ 10
Done.
[ 4.164719] kjournald starting. Commit interval 5 seconds
[ 4.165776] EXT3-fs: mounted filesystem with ordered data mode.
Begin: Running /scripts/local-bottom ...
[ 4.459734] e1000: 0000:00:02.0: e1000_probe: (PCI:33MHz:32-bit) d0:0d:3f:04:07:fe
Done.
Done.
Begin: Running /scripts/init-bottom ...
Done.
[ 4.554572] e1000: eth0: e1000_probe: Intel(R) PRO/1000 Network Connection
[ 4.768202] EXT3-fs warning: checktime reached, running e2fsck is recommended
[ 4.793158] EXT3 FS on sda1, internal journal
consuming user data failed!
Traceback (most recent call last):
  File "/usr/bin/cloud-init", line 90, in <module>
    main()
  File "/usr/bin/cloud-init", line 47, in main
    cloud.consume_userdata,[],False)
  File "/usr/lib/python2.6/dist-packages/cloudinit/__init__.py", line 215, in sem_and_run
    if self.sem_has_run(semname,freq): return
  File "/usr/lib/python2.6/dist-packages/cloudinit/__init__.py", line 173, in sem_has_run
    semfile = self.sem_getpath(name,freq)
  File "/usr/lib/python2.6/dist-packages/cloudinit/__init__.py", line 167, in sem_getpath
    freqtok = self.datasource.get_instance_id()
  File "/usr/lib/python2.6/dist-packages/cloudinit/DataSourceEc2.py", line 64, in get_instance_id
    return(self.metadata['instance-id'])
KeyError: 'instance-id'
init: cloud-init main process (538) terminated with status 1
mountall: Event failed
 * Starting AppArmor profiles [ OK ]
Traceback (most recent call last):
  File "/usr/bin/cloud-init-cfg", line 56, in <module>
    main()
  File "/usr/bin/cloud-init-cfg", line 43, in main
    cc = cloudinit.CloudConfig.CloudConfig(cfg_path)
  File "/usr/lib/python2.6/dist-packages/cloudinit/CloudConfig.py", line 42, in __init__
Traceback (most recent call last):
  File "/usr/bin/cloud-init-cfg", line 56, in <module>
    main()
  File "/usr/bin/cloud-init-cfg", line 43, in main
    cc = cloudinit.CloudConfig.CloudConfig(cfg_path)
  File "/usr/lib/python2.6/dist-packages/cloudinit/CloudConfig.py", line 42, in __init__
    self.cfg = self.get_config_obj(cfgfile)
  File "/usr/lib/python2.6/dist-packages/cloudinit/CloudConfig.py", line 53, in get_config_obj
    self.cfg = self.get_config_obj(cfgfile)
  File "/usr/lib/python2.6/dist-packages/cloudinit/CloudConfig.py", line 53, in get_config_obj
    f=file(cfgfile)
IOError: [Errno 2] No such file or directory: '/var/lib/cloud/data/cloud-config.txt'

Thanks for your support!

[0] http://open.eucalyptus.com/forum/possible-bug-when-dns-server-has-names-elastic-ips
[1] http://open.eucalyptus.com/forum/lucid-image-image-store-x8664-doesnt-run

Revision history for this message
Luca Invernizzi (invernizzi) wrote :
Daniel Nurmi (nurmi)
Changed in eucalyptus:
assignee: nobody → Daniel Nurmi (nurmi)
Revision history for this message
Lukas Lundell (lukaslundell) wrote :

Having the same issue with the 10.04 Lucid image on the image store. 9.10 image works fine.

Revision history for this message
Lukas Lundell (lukaslundell) wrote :

Would also note that for me its the i386 version of the image that has this same stack trace with "consuming user data failed!".

Revision history for this message
wisdom harris (wisdomharris) wrote :

hi guys am having the same problems with mounted-tmp, please let know if you found some workaround

Revision history for this message
Yehia (yehia) wrote :

same problem. only 9.10 on i386 seems to work.

Revision history for this message
Andy Grimm (agrimm) wrote :

This issue is now being tracked upstream at http://eucalyptus.atlassian.net/browse/EUCA-2751

Please watch that issue for further updates.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Bug attachments

Remote bug watches

Bug watches keep track of this bug in other bug trackers.